Error Code P0736
Definition A/T Incorrect Reverse Gear Ratio
Possible Causes:

Reverse Gear is damaged or has failed

LR clutch is damaged, leaking or has failed

Problems related to the Input Speed or Output Speed sensor

Problems related to the transmission valve body
Condition For Setting The Code:

DTC P0500 not set, engine started, vehicle driven to a speed of over 3 mph with Reverse Gear commanded "on", and the PCM detected an incorrect Reverse Gear ratio during the CCM Rationality test.
